How Vitamin A Supplements Can Reduce Measles Complications

Measles, a highly contagious viral infection, remains a major health concern, especially in regions with limited access to healthcare. While vaccination is the most effective way to prevent measles, vitamin A supplements play a crucial role in reducing the severity of complications in those who contract the disease.

Understanding Measles and Its Impact

Measles is characterized by symptoms such as high fever, cough, runny nose, inflamed eyes, and a distinctive red rash. In severe cases, it can lead to:

  • pneumonia
  • encephalitis
  • death

Children under five years old and those with compromised immune systems are particularly vulnerable.

The Role of Vitamin A

Vitamin A is essential for maintaining a healthy immune system and supporting the body’s ability to fight infections. It also protects and maintains the integrity of epithelial tissues, which line the respiratory and gastrointestinal tracts. When children are deficient in vitamin A, they are at a higher risk of developing severe complications from measles.

How Vitamin A Supplements Help

Research has shown that providing high-dose vitamin A supplements to children with measles can:

  1. Reduce Mortality Rates: Studies indicate that vitamin A supplementation can lower measles-related mortality by up to 50% in children under five.
  2. Prevent Severe Complications: Vitamin A helps reduce the risk of pneumonia, diarrhea, and other secondary infections.
  3. Support Faster Recovery: Children receiving vitamin A often experience quicker recovery times and fewer long-term complications.

World Health Organization (WHO) Recommendations

The WHO recommends administering vitamin A supplements to all children diagnosed with measles in areas where vitamin A deficiency is prevalent. Typically, two doses are given 24 hours apart to ensure optimal benefits. This intervention is both cost-effective and lifesaving.

While vaccination remains the first line of defense against measles, vitamin A supplementation serves as a vital secondary measure to reduce complications and save lives. Ensuring access to vitamin A supplements in vulnerable communities can make a significant difference in global health outcomes.
